How to get from Armenia to Bogota

Travelling between Armenia and Bogota is possible by Flight, bus and taxi. Flight guarantees the fastest travel on this route. Bus is the slowest option.

The most expensive ticket will cost you USD 479.01 if you go by taxi; to keep it budget-friendly, opt for a bus which will set you back mere USD 20.63.

How long does it take to get from Armenia to Bogota?

It can take you anywhere between 1 and 9 hours to travel between Armenia and Bogota depending on the means of transport you choose.

Flight is the fastest way to travel between Armenia and Bogota. Flight will bring you to your destination in 54m. Bus does a much slower job and take about 9h to reach Bogota.

What mode of transportation is the best one for my route?

Flights

Flying is the fastest and often the most expensive way to travel from Armenia to Bogota, but with a bit of luck you can score very good deals for as little as USD 35.15.

Things to remember: Note that some of the airlines may have restrictions on checked luggage weight or require paying extra for check-in, choosing seats or transportation of oversized luggage.

If opting for a flight, calculate the time you will spend getting to and from the airports as well as the waiting time before your flight, getting through immigration in case of an international flight and recovering your checked luggage.

In certain cases all these procedures can add no less than 5 hours to your total travel time.

Airlines flying between Armenia and Bogota

Avianca, LATAM Airlines Group, Wingo

Bus

Travelling from Armenia to Bogota overland will inevitably take longer but in many cases it is the cheapest option if you opt for a bus.

Things to remember: For a more comfortable ride opt for a higher-class bus wherever possible. These buses usually have soft reclining seats and are equipped with air-conditioning and on-board toilets.

They often include water, snacks or a light lunch into your ticket price and make bathroom stops en-route.

Taxi

Some travellers consider taxi to be the most convenient form of overland transport thanks to flexible departure times, a possibility to choose the size of the car you need, and a hassle-free door-to-door service.

Things to remember: If you are planning to make detours during your trip, discuss it with your driver or service provider in advance as it may affect the price.
